2015 was a crazy busy year for Emily Crump Photography!  I met so many sweet new families and loved photographing many new babies in the studio this past year.  The business thrived last year and 2016 is looking to be an even more busy year, but something just will not settle in my heart.  I used to want to book every single session that asked to book with me.  Seeing my calendar completely full with sessions every month and editing the nights away was what I justified in my mind as a successful business.  A successful business I had built from the ground up and boy, was I proud of it!  But then I started to realize what I have been missing.  I’ve missed being at home to tell the my kids goodnight at the end of a long day because I was chasing the good evening sunset light at a session.  I’ve missed Saturday soccer games during the fall busy season because I had a day packed with sessions.  I’ve missed story time at night because I was editing at the computer.  I’ve missed alone time with the husband because I’m answering emails or editing, or packing up orders after the kids are in bed.  After 5 years of this I have decided to take a step back.
This year I am going to purposely live in the moment with my own children and family.  No more finding childcare for an evening shoot before my husband gets home or missing that Saturday baseball and soccer game or gymnastics meet to run to a session.  In 2016 they will be my priority.  I will once again become the more stay-at-home mom that my husband and I decided would be best for our family, than the business owner out to book more sessions and grow the business.
With all that being said, I will not be taking any family or children sessions for at least the first part of 2016.  However, I will not be closing the doors to ECP in all aspects.
I will be concentrating on my newborn photography business that I can do from the studio during the hours when my children are in school.  I will be taking between 3-4 newborn sessions a month in the studio.   Those sessions will be done during school-time morning hours.  These sessions will book up quickly so please email me today if you are expecting or in need of a newborn session.
I also will not be booking any newborn sessions at all in the months of June through August to allow my un-divided attention to be on my own children during their summer break.
This is hard decision and one that I did not easily or quickly make.  I do not know what the future holds for adding back in family and children’s sessions at ECP but for right now I feel as though this is right for my family.  I am so very thankful to each and every one of you that have grown my business to where it is today, I never would have imagined my business growing to this level when I started back in 2010.  I have loved getting to know all your families over the years and watching your children grow.  I will miss the sweet “Hi Miss Emily, do I get a ring pop after this?!” or the sweet big hugs that I get from so many of your precious children.
Thank you for understanding my heart on this matter.  I pray that you all have a happy and healthy 2016 year!  Make it the best one yet!
